ORDER OF DISMISSAL
The above-entitled and numbered civil action was heretofore referred to United States
Magistrate Judge Don D. Bush. The Report and Recommendation of the Magistrate Judge, which
contains proposed findings of fact and recommendations for the disposition of such action, has been
presented for consideration, and no objections thereto having been timely filed, the court is of the
opinion that the findings and conclusions of the Magistrate Judge are correct, and adopts same as the
findings and conclusions of the court. It is therefore
ORDERED that the motion to vacate, set aside or correct Movant’s sentence pursuant to 28
U.S.C. § 2255 is DISMISSED without prejudice for lack of jurisdiction. All motions not previously
ruled on are hereby DENIED.
